Inspection on 12/5/2024

High Priority
1
Intermediate
0
Basic
3
Total
4
Disposition: Follow-up Inspection Required

Inspection Details:

  • 14-11-5:Basic - Equipment in poor repair. Large floor mixer observed to be rusted with peeing paint on the head, which could allow flaking paint to fall into the bowl. **Warning**
  • 36-24-5:Basic - Hole in or other damage to wall. Peeling surface observed on the wall in the dish room. Operator stated materials are on-site and repairs are scheduled. **Warning**
  • 23-03-4:Basic - Nonfood-contact surface soiled with grease, food debris, dirt, slime or dust. Soda gun at the bar had build-up on the inner surface. **Warning**
  • 03A-02-5:High Priority - Time/temperature control for safety food cold held at greater than 41 degrees Fahrenheit. In the walk-in cooler: shrimp (48F - Cold Holding); steak (49F - Cold Holding); prime rib (49F - Cold Holding); ahi tuna (47F - Cold Holding); chicken tenders (48F - Cold Holding); chicken wings (48F - Cold Holding); cooked rice (49F - Cold Holding); fettuccine alfredo (49F - Cold Holding); steak mac prep (49F - Cold Holding). Unit observed have ice build up under the fan unit. Operator called for emergency repair and began icing all product in the cooler to rapidly bring food temperatures down. **Corrective Action Taken** **Warning**
